Belmont Park
Race 5
#6 Remoane (12-1) switches to turf after a fading unplaced effort, showing some early run at this distance on Aqueduct's main track in her debut in mid-March. Chestnut should be suited to grass being by Karakontie and out of a mare by Hard Spun, and trainer Morley has won with 26% of his runners since the beginning of the year. Filly can be in good position from the start with Alvarado retaining the mount.
Race 6
A competitive allowance on grass includes #3 Madita (7-2), who has not been seen since weakening to finish fifth as the favorite after being keen early over a mile at Belmont last September. Gray had some good form in Germany before closing to finish a good third at Saratoga two back in her first start for trainer Delacour, who wins with 28% of his runners that have not raced for 90+ days. Gray has been working well at Fair Hills and can be forwardly placed throughout with Irad Ortiz up.
Race 7
Trainer Cox wins with 20% of his runners that have not raced for 90+ days and saddles #10 Inside Info (4-1), who last raced when fifth in a small stakes at Finger Lakes in September in her second outing. Gelding posted a sharp 4-furlong work from the gate in :48 here six days ago in advance of his first outing for Cox, who wins with 28% overall in maiden claiming events. Dark bay can be tough at this level under Castellano.
Race 8
#7 Dream Friend (6-1) has not raced since finishing a close second at Aqueduct after leading early in November, finishing just ahead of Instilled Regard, who won the Ft. Lauderdale (G2) in his next outing. Son of Ghostzapper won one of two previous starts at this distance and has been working steadily for trainer Terranova, who wins with 24% of his runners that have not raced for 90+ days. 5-year-old can be on or near the early lead with Lezcano riding.
Gulfstream Park
Race 5
Maidens going 5-furlongs on grass include #1 Our Little Devil (8-1), who tries turf for the first time off a fading unplaced effort facing better on the main track early last month in her first start since February. Daughter of 14% turf sire Daredevil is a half-sister to one winner on grass and trainer Deaton won with two of his last nine runners making this surface change. Chestnut figures to be the one to catch breaking from the rail with apprentice Fuentes in the saddle.
Tampa Bay Downs
Race 8
#3 Monkey Mind (4-1) has a career record of 14-5-2-3 on grass and comes off a narrow loss when closing to finish second over the course and distance in early-April. Trainer Nations wins with 12% of his runners that have not raced for 46-90 days and with 21% of his starters on turf. Dark bay can be on or near the early lead with Mena retaining the mount.
Lone Star Park
Race 8
Trainer Sharp wins with 20% of his runners that have not raced for 90+ days and saddles #2 Quebec (2-1), who has not raced since fading to finish sixth at Fair Grounds in the Stall Memorial S. in mid-February. Daughter of Into Mischief has a record of 28-7-7-2 on turf and makes her fourth outing for Sharp, who wins with 19% of his runners on grass. Bay appears to have found an easy spot for her return and can be forwardly placed throughout with Cabrera in the irons.
